From nobody Mon Jan 19 09:53:59 2026 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4dvm4m1bY2z6PlQK for ; Mon, 19 Jan 2026 09:54:00 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R13"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4dvm4m0Hq0z3rtJ for ; Mon, 19 Jan 2026 09:54:00 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1768816440;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=kB0VDeKUeF0PastF35UiIhcH0VsTiiTMkxxzY64BLrE=; b=b3ozxmoYoofrp2dC5Req2hC6sZ1EqoTpy8e0TXJDCMppJi0R0EBF++bbZAVDhYm9lys2OC xRatEp1kUnQNOuSerh8v9CGIYeFgAOpFC69+5e86ETGpU9EtaSvgDqS5FL5XaPkuK9FzUC 3m7Voi84ABe1S7sMtdd8ZBK99NtRhl6/QpdapQ6LkRx3+vqHXVs1JFqU1VB6qaaJTpD8Pd agbejMx6qsFa/Roon2s20KpSwgYlMUXg8+SUFiObEH59sMl2eLn/I3RAt7V8eVyJ3I57em tkqbkElXca4C1aURv+JhTb6/B49EKA4NH8wjdbHzxNXFjf+MzREKkhJemVCqCw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1768816440;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=kB0VDeKUeF0PastF35UiIhcH0VsTiiTMkxxzY64BLrE=; b=x0ayiZ9Ep5oAWWajF/2TaGETgNCA+zNfUSVaCEwZWY6ON6KiSIHE/Ed7CpQM2kO5RiVhih bPClY2Cv+X+tGIhk33ub50Fz2mXPObCOV8sSZroAI29A2HU6slZj9UqQiWMgltyOr/trYV +M6/2xHCUnfBZOZqX0WKavvdwCuVO0ktldZQ3+OtbS8wbJOETGjeQb3Df+2JW6oxrK8rBP ZJ3KH6joZye0gCrHBPG9KYzet+coXZbZRFQqBZzVaI5gh/dm8ZLbg8NJn4TxUyAHbhjUlc nWp/lQkra84dPNZO+6OyyDOunwRcFitGCHTgmbNghgie8bCEqf8wDUV+0WJZtA==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1768816440; a=rsa-sha256; cv=none; b=t9BBy8a2GU8F70HQtuyyJSrohqzLCqBqaua8x2ORHKchjcb3HOxUcpM2u6LN3zWv5vtFcT PlDuVXal88Yfkt38WiK4S6FiLgOENKgSTWvtZgqhmhEOXY7AtJuiy2uRtJUJetQtZNOV3v bLc7dtu9+gZRU9jhYPJKyH2hoxVPfpjIyxIjmZjZph8W6QmrrYctkmXfTH7E/PHAmtXghX uFKkOxHk29e1+CrtwRWnmNXeLtuAnGslpyuQUxcAyZ/DajNf7SVsp6uqe3/bMPi5KtIXlk miHp5enVENr8SUhNLHTar5sa3L5tbPzyWnv1QnKSSuj1ZaFYnbLSsL1JbX+QmQ== ARC-Authentication-Results: i=1; mx1.freebsd.org; none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) by mxrelay.nyi.freebsd.org (Postfix) with ESMTP id 4dvm4l6yrKzBYs for ; Mon, 19 Jan 2026 09:53:59 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from git (uid 1279) (envelope-from git@FreeBSD.org) id 232e5 by gitrepo.freebsd.org (DragonFly Mail Agent v0.13+ on gitrepo.freebsd.org); Mon, 19 Jan 2026 09:53:59 +0000 To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Yuri Victorovich Subject: git: 1f7f63582a03 - main - net/zapret2: New port: DPI (Deep Packet Interderence) bypass (Gen 2) List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-ports-main@freebsd.org Sender: owner-dev-commits-ports-main@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: yuri X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 1f7f63582a0350c2159a25bc7af72a73faf26c91 Auto-Submitted: auto-generated Date: Mon, 19 Jan 2026 09:53:59 +0000 Message-Id: <696dff37.232e5.5567c1a2@gitrepo.freebsd.org> The branch main has been updated by yuri: URL: https://cgit.FreeBSD.org/ports/commit/?id=1f7f63582a0350c2159a25bc7af72a73faf26c91 commit 1f7f63582a0350c2159a25bc7af72a73faf26c91 Author: Yuri Victorovich AuthorDate: 2026-01-19 08:42:31 +0000 Commit: Yuri Victorovich CommitDate: 2026-01-19 09:53:37 +0000 net/zapret2: New port: DPI (Deep Packet Interderence) bypass (Gen 2) --- net/Makefile | 1 + net/zapret2/Makefile | 28 ++++++++++++++++++++++++++++ net/zapret2/distinfo | 3 +++ net/zapret2/pkg-descr | 3 +++ 4 files changed, 35 insertions(+) diff --git a/net/Makefile b/net/Makefile index 854d2e7f7ff1..9b8fc3e9e753 100644 --- a/net/Makefile +++ b/net/Makefile @@ -1728,6 +1728,7 @@ SUBDIR += yggdrasil SUBDIR += yptransitd SUBDIR += zapret + SUBDIR += zapret2 SUBDIR += zebra-server SUBDIR += zerotier SUBDIR += zmap diff --git a/net/zapret2/Makefile b/net/zapret2/Makefile new file mode 100644 index 000000000000..413555fc8356 --- /dev/null +++ b/net/zapret2/Makefile @@ -0,0 +1,28 @@ +PORTNAME= zapret2 +DISTVERSIONPREFIX= v +DISTVERSION= 0.8.6 +CATEGORIES= net + +MAINTAINER= yuri@FreeBSD.org +COMMENT= DPI (Deep Packet Interderence) bypass (Gen 2) +WWW= https://github.com/bol-van/zapret + +LICENSE= MIT +LICENSE_FILE= ${WRKSRC}/docs/LICENSE.txt + +USES= lua luajit pkgconfig + +USE_GITHUB= yes +GH_ACCOUNT= bol-van + +PLIST_FILES= ${EXES:S/^/bin\//} + +EXES= dvtws2 ip2net mdig + +do-install: +.for exe in ${EXES} + ${INSTALL_PROGRAM} ${WRKSRC}/binaries/my/${exe} \ + ${STAGEDIR}${PREFIX}/bin +.endfor + +.include diff --git a/net/zapret2/distinfo b/net/zapret2/distinfo new file mode 100644 index 000000000000..2f555e5de21a --- /dev/null +++ b/net/zapret2/distinfo @@ -0,0 +1,3 @@ +TIMESTAMP = 1768811224 +SHA256 (bol-van-zapret2-v0.8.6_GH0.tar.gz) = 1fb5f27fec217db6283b937d3b9650fae75ef0a79cca0bd24ec7437939a30171 +SIZE (bol-van-zapret2-v0.8.6_GH0.tar.gz) = 542272 diff --git a/net/zapret2/pkg-descr b/net/zapret2/pkg-descr new file mode 100644 index 000000000000..8a4745a2fe23 --- /dev/null +++ b/net/zapret2/pkg-descr @@ -0,0 +1,3 @@ +zapret2 is a stand-alone (without 3rd party servers) DPI circumvention tool. +May allow to bypass http(s) website blocking or speed shaping, resist signature +tcp/udp protocol discovery.